kvm和docker的區別:kvm是全虛擬化,需要模擬各種硬件,docker是容器,共享宿主機的CPU,內存,swap等。本文安裝的qemu-kvm屬於kvm虛擬化,其中:kvm負責cpu虛擬化和內存虛擬化,QEMU模擬IO設備(網卡、磁盤等)。 參考資料: qemu和docker ...
為了宿主機和虛擬機可以很好的通信,當然是選擇橋接網絡啦 話不多說 配置橋接網絡 虛擬機雖然能夠上網了,但是宿主機並不能與虛擬機通信,這給開發調試帶來了很多的困難。我們希望的是,可以用ssh連上虛擬機。這就要求虛擬機就像一台物理機一樣,與宿主機存在於同一個網段內。 首先,在宿主機上,安裝必要的工具 為了tunctl命令 : 以下命令均是在su下進行若是認證失敗,請輸入sudo passwd roo ...
2019-05-24 14:51 0 1057 推薦指數:
kvm和docker的區別:kvm是全虛擬化,需要模擬各種硬件,docker是容器,共享宿主機的CPU,內存,swap等。本文安裝的qemu-kvm屬於kvm虛擬化,其中:kvm負責cpu虛擬化和內存虛擬化,QEMU模擬IO設備(網卡、磁盤等)。 參考資料: qemu和docker ...
實驗名稱: kvm環境下使用qemu-kvm創建虛擬機之間的網絡配置 實驗環境: 保證kvm環境正常即可,擁有qemu-kvm管理工具; 同時,我們這里離需要擁有bridge-utils橋工具 實驗需求: 1、保證kvm環境的正常運行; 2、安裝qemu-kvm ...
首先闡述一下kvm與qemu的關系,kvm是修改過的qemu,而且使用了硬件支持的仿真,仿真速度比QEMU快。 配置kvm/qemu的網絡有兩種方法。其一,默認方式為用戶模式網絡(Usermode Networking),數據包由NAT方式通過主機的接口進行傳送。 其二,使用橋接方式 ...
) 管理工具棧: qemu-kvm ...
三種方式創建虛擬機 1.qemu-kvm來創建虛擬機 2.用virsh來創建 3.virt-manager來創建 [root@kvm1 kvm]# qemu-img snapshot -c ...
一.虛擬化介紹 在X86平台的虛擬化技術中,新引入的虛擬化層通常稱為虛擬化監控器(Virtual Machine Monitor,VMM),也叫Hypervisor。在虛擬化中,VMM必須能截 ...
不同的基於KVM的虛擬化平台,可能會采用不同的虛擬化組件,目前主流的采用QEMU-KVM組件,但在不同的產品里版本有所不同,功能也有差異,下面就幾個概念進行梳理下 KVM:Kernel-Based Virtual Machine 基於內核的虛擬機,是Linux內核的一個可加載模塊,通過調用 ...
What's QEMU QEMU是一個主機上的VMM(virtual machine monitor),通過動態二進制轉換來模擬CPU,並提供一系列的硬件模型,使guest os認為自己和硬件直接打交道,其實是同QEMU模擬出來的硬件打交道,QEMU再將這些指令翻譯給真正硬件進行操作。通過這種 ...